So, strangely enough the bud does not reproduce when i declare war on kingdoms, just on duchies.
But when i declare on war on kingdoms and empires u get a different bug. After winning th war (btw nice addition that conquering a trade post does not initially destroy it) the trade post is removed. But i cannot build a new one because it says still a merchant republic controls the trade post (which is non-existant). I guess in cleanslate you tried to code in trade post not getting destroyed on conquer which is great but still after winning the war there must have abeen an old part of code which makes the trade post dissapear. I was not able to build a new one and the situation stayed the same for a couple of years when i saw the feudal owner of the province had built a new tradepost.
